		<pub:abstract><![CDATA[The trend that electronic markets are taking, aided by the concommitant development of mobile devices suggest a major change from the way electronic commerce is done today. The increased use of PDAs, laptops has showed us a new horizon of proliferation in the electronic market.  When e-commerce services and transaction processing facilities need to be accessed from a wireless device,new and challenging research problems come into the picture.  Discovering services dynamically will become increasingly important in the mobile e­commerce scenario. In the near future, a service would be selected automatically for a job, taking into consideration its physical location, context re­ lated and other semantic information.  To support such a picture, the existing discovery mechanisms need to move beyond trivial attribute or interface matching.  They would be much more knowledge based. In this paper, we present a summary of the existing service discovery protocols and the work that we have done in the service discovery area in our quest to make service discovery more dynamic.]]></pub:abstract>
